This interface imposes a total ordering on the objects of each class that implements it. This ordering is referred to as the class's natural ordering, and the class's compareTo method is referred to as its natural comparison method. Lists (and arrays) of objects that implement this interface can be sorted automatically by ... Java enum has already build in compareTo (..) method, which uses the enum position (aka ordinal) to compare one object to other. The position is determined based on the order in which the enum constants are declared , where the first constant is assigned an ordinal of zero. If you were to make this …compareTo () returns the difference of first unmatched character in the two compared strings. If no unmatch is found, and one string comes out as shorter than other one, then the length difference is returned. "hello".compareTo("meklo") = 'h' - 'm' = -5. ^ ^.Oct 10, 2023 · Their system, built on Java, has a product listing page where items are sorted based on their names.
